It's National Safe Boating Week and we want to remind all boaters to brush up on boating safety skills and prepare for the boating season. π€
According to the latest U.S. Coast Guard statistics for 2021, where cause of death was known, 81% of fatal boating accident victims drowned. Of those drowning victims, 83% were not wearing a life jacket. Always wearing a life jacket while on the water can save your life. π¦Ί
In Delaware when on a boat, it is required for anyone 12 and under to have a life jacket on and itβs recommended for all. Those over 12 not wearing a life jacket, still must have a life jacket easily accessible and fitted to them on board.
Your boatβs safety equipment must also include a sound producing device, like a horn or a whistle; a fire extinguisher; a Type IV throwable (a cushion or ring buoy designed to be thrown to someone in trouble) and navigation lights. ππ§―
